Development Agenda for Western Nigeria, DAWN Commission has officially announced the death of one of its key staff members, Mr. Abiodun Oladipo.
In a social media post on Friday, the management of DAWN expressed grief over the death of Mr Oladipo who was, until his demise, the Head of Programmes at the Commission.

With deep sadness and heavy hearts, we announce the passing of our valued colleague, Mr. Abiodun Oladipo (2nd January 1982 – 9th April 2026), after a brief illness. He was 44 years old.
As Head of Programmes, Biodun was pivotal to DAWN Commission’s regional integration agenda, a task to which he dedicated himself wholeheartedly since joining us in 2016. He tirelessly crisscrossed the six South-West states, forging connections and building bridges that advanced our collective vision for regional integration and development.
Beyond his professional contributions, Biodun was deeply admirable and served as a mentor to many of us. His guidance, warmth, and unwavering commitment to excellence left an indelible mark on all who had the privilege of working with him.
We are heartbroken by this profound loss and extend our deepest sympathies to his family during this difficult time.
In accordance with the family’s wishes, Mr. Oladipo will be laid to rest in a private burial ceremony.
